Apply OSHA's double-connection (clipped connection) requirements when two members share common bolt holes at a column or beam-over-column

Steps

  1. Identify locations where two structural members on opposite sides of a column web, or a beam web over a column, will share common connection holes.
  2. Confirm a shop- or field-attached seat (or equivalent connection device) is supplied to independently secure the first-connected member, per 1926.756(c).
  3. If no seat/equivalent device is used, ensure at least one bolt with a wrench-tight nut remains engaged in the first member at all times during the connection sequence, per 1926.756(c).
  4. Sequence erection so the first member is never left connected only by shared, unbolted holes while the second member is placed.
  5. Reference Subpart R Appendix H illustrations of clipped-end and staggered connections when training crews on acceptable configurations.
